Waghjali Population - Yavatmal, Maharashtra
Waghjali is a medium size village located in Pusad Taluka of Yavatmal district, Maharashtra with total 237 families residing. The Waghjali village has population of 1238 of which 658 are males while 580 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Waghjali village population of children with age 0-6 is 205 which makes up 16.56 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Waghjali village is 881 which is lower than Maharashtra state average of 929. Child Sex Ratio for the Waghjali as per census is 667, lower than Maharashtra average of 894.
Waghjali village has lower literacy rate compared to Maharashtra. In 2011, literacy rate of Waghjali village was 55.28 % compared to 82.34 % of Maharashtra. In Waghjali Male literacy stands at 69.91 % while female literacy rate was 39.56 %.
